Title:
EVAPORATED FUEL PROCESSING DEVICE OF CAR

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To provide a device which adsorbs the evaporated fuel in a fuel tank to an adsorbent in a canister and which can effectively separate the fuel from the adsorbent when necessary using a simple constitution.

CONSTITUTION: The rear frame 42 of a car body 41 is composed of a left and a right side member 43, 44, a cross-member 45 to coupled together the side members 43, 44, and a floor pan 46 installed between them 43-45. The floor pan 46 is furnished with a tire housing 48. Near the members 43-46, 48, an exhaust pipe 50 is installed for admitting passage of the exhaust gas emitted from the engine. A canister 13 to contain an adsorbent for the evaporated fuel in a fuel tank 1 is installed in the space bounded by the members 43-46, 48, 50. When the engine is in operation, the adsorbent in the canister 13 is heated effectively by the heat of the exhaust gas passing through the exhaust pipe 50, which accelerates fuel separation from the adsorbent.
